Nestled in the southeastern region of Michigan, Taylor is a welcoming city that offers a unique blend of suburban charm and accessibility to urban amenities. With a population estimated to be around 61,000 residents, Taylor provides a close-knit community atmosphere that many find appealing, especially seniors looking for a comfortable place to settle down.

The city is known for its rich history and the Heritage Park, a sprawling green space that offers a serene setting for leisurely walks and family picnics. It also features historical buildings, a petting farm, and a playground, making it a popular destination for both locals and visitors of all ages. Additionally, Taylor is home to the Southland Center, a shopping mall that caters to a variety of tastes and preferences, and the Lakes of Taylor Golf Club, which is perfect for golf enthusiasts.

Taylor's location within the Detroit metropolitan area means that residents can easily access the cultural and medical facilities of a larger city while enjoying the comforts of a smaller community. This balance makes Taylor particularly suitable for seniors who appreciate the quieter pace of suburban living but still want the option to engage with a larger, bustling cityscape.

Assisted Living Costs in Taylor, Michigan

When considering the transition to assisted living, understanding the costs involved is crucial for families and individuals making this important decision. In Taylor, Michigan, the landscape of assisted living costs reflects both the local economic factors and the broader trends of healthcare in the region.

Recent data indicates that the monthly median cost of assisted living facilities in Michigan stands at approximately $4,250, which is notably lower than the national average. This is encouraging news for residents of Taylor and the surrounding areas, as it suggests that access to assisted living services can be more affordable compared to other regions of the country.

In Taylor itself, the average cost for assisted living services is slightly higher, averaging around $5,092 per month. This cost typically covers a range of services including housing, meals, and assistance with da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ication management. The specific level of care and the types of services required can influence the overall cost, with more comprehensive care options incurring higher fees.

For those concerned about managing these expenses, it's important to note that there are government support programs available to help. In Michigan, programs like Medicaid and the MI Choice Waiver Program can assist eligible seniors in covering the costs of assisted living. These programs are designed to help those with limited income and resources to access the care they need.

Residents of Taylor also benefit from proximity to reputable medical facilities such as Beaumont Hospital, Taylor, which ensures that high-quality healthcare services are within reach when additional medical attention is required.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Taylor, Michigan

When considering long-term care options in Taylor, Michigan, it's essential to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ities. Each type of care caters to specific needs and preferences, offering a range of services and amenities.

Assisted Living facilities in Taylor provide residents with personal care assistance, medication management, and various social activities. These communities are designed for individuals who require help with daily tasks but still wish to maintain a level of independence. They typically offer private or semi-private accommodations, communal dining, and support services.

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as standalone communities, specialize in caring for those with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, and other memory impairments. These facilities offer structured environments with set routines to help reduce stress for residents. Enhanced security measures are in place to prevent wandering, a common concern for individuals with memory loss.

Nursing Homes, also known as Skilled Nursing Facilities, provide a higher level of medical care. They cater to residents with serious health issues who need 24-hour supervision by licensed healthcare professionals. Nursing Homes offer both short-term rehabilitation services and long-term care for chronic conditions.

Independent Living communities are ideal for seniors who can live without assistance but seek the convenience and social opportunities of a senior community. These facilities often provide amenities such as fitness centers, group outings, and various clubs, allowing residents to enjoy their retirement with minimal responsibilities.

Choosing the right type of facility in Taylor, Michigan, depends on an individual's health status, level of independence, and personal preferences. Assessing the level of care required is the first step in making an informed decision for yourself or a loved one. Each option offers a unique blend of support, community, and healthcare tailored to the needs of seniors at different stages of their lives.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Taylor, Michigan

Qualifying for assisted living in Taylor, Michigan, involves meeting certain criteria that pertain to an individual's health status and financial situation. To begin with, candidates for assisted living typically need to demonstrate a need for daily assistance with activities such as bathing, dressing, meal preparation, and medication management. This need is often assessed through a health evaluation by a medical professional.

Financially, individuals must consider the costs associated with assisted living facilities. In Taylor, Michigan, these costs can vary widely based on the level of care required and the amenities offered by the facility. Most residents pay for assisted living through personal savings, retirement funds, long-term care insurance, or the sale of assets like a home.

For those concerned about the financial aspect, government programs can be a lifeline. In Michigan, the Medicaid Waiver Program for the Elderly and Disabled may offer financial assistance to those who qualify. To be eligible for this program, applicants must meet certain income and asset limits. It's important to apply for Medicaid and any waivers well in advance, as there can be waiting lists or processing times to consider.

Additionally, the MI Choice Waiver Program provides an option for eligible seniors who may otherwise require nursing home care to receive services in an assisted living setting. This program includes a variety of services such as community transition services, chore services, counseling, and respite care for caregivers.

To navigate these requirements and secure the necessary qualifications, it's often helpful to consult with a senior care advisor or an elder law attorney. They can provide guidance on the application process for government assistance programs and offer tips on financial planning for long-term care.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Taylor, Michigan

When considering assisted living options, Taylor, Michigan, presents a unique set of benefits and challenges for seniors and their families. It's important to weigh these carefully to make the best decision for your loved one's needs.

One significant advantage of assisted living in Taylor is the community-centric approach. Many facilities in the area offer a warm, friendly atmosphere that reflects the city's close-knit community values. Residents often have access to personalized care and a variety of social activities that keep them engaged and connected to their peers.

Moreover, the cost of living in Taylor is relatively affordable compared to other regions in Michigan, which can extend to savings in assisted living expenses. This financial aspect can be a relief for families working within a budget, ensuring that their loved ones receive quality care without the stress of overwhelming costs.

Assisted living facilities in Taylor also tend to have strong ties to local healthcare providers, ensuring residents receive comprehensive medical attention when needed. The proximity to hospitals and clinics can provide peace of mind to families, knowing that advanced care is readily accessible.

However, there are disadvantages to consider as well. One potential downside is the Michigan weather, which can be harsh in the winter months. For seniors who are sensitive to the cold or who have mobility issues, this can be a significant concern. The winter season can sometimes limit outdoor activities and make transportation challenging.

Additionally, while Taylor offers a variety of assisted living options, the selection may not be as extensive as in larger metropolitan areas. This could mean fewer choices in terms of facility size, amenities, and specialized care programs for conditions such as dementia or Alzheimer's.
